'1Jtl71 EVENT DESCRIPTION On February 13, 1992, at 1920 hours0.0222 days <br />0.533 hours <br />0.00317 weeks <br />7.3056e-4 months <br />, the control room ventilation system [VI] inadvertently switched to the emergency mode. At the time of occurrence, the plant was in cold shutdown and the primary coolant system was depressurized.

The control room operators immediately verified that there was not a valid containment high (CHP) or a containment high radiation (CHR) signal present. It was subsequently determined that Electrical Mairitenance was .replacing damaged flex conduit [IK;CND] on the CHR relay 5R;6 [IK;RLY]

When the wire on relay point 16, was disconnected, the electrical circuit scheme SlOl de-energized causing the "A" train of Ctintrol Room HVAC to automatically switch to the @mergency mode .. The Electrical Supervisor was notified.of the actuation.

The work described under the work order was completed and circuit was re-terminated.

This event is reportable to the NRC per 10CFR50,J3(a)(2)(iv) as an event that resulted in the automatic actuation of an Engineered Safety Feature, the Room HVAC. CAUSE OF THE EVENT De-energization of emergency HVAC activation relays by lifting wire in the . control room emergency HVAC system activation sc.heme (SlOl) was caused by a combination of inadequate job planning and personnel

  • This event did not involve the failure of equipment to $afety. ANALYSIS OF THE EVENT The.job plan for the work order called for.the on relay SR-6, point 16, to be lifted in order to remove it from a crushed flex conduit. Following removal from the flex conduit the wire was to be inspected for damage. When the wire was lifted, the.continuity of the circuit was broken causing the circuit to thereby activating the .relay to automatically switch* .the control room HVAC to the emergency mode; Although the job plan was incorr.ect in that it did not identify the electrical scheme as a "de-energize to actuate

scheme; it did the electricians to the correct electrical prints (E-271, Sh. 8) whi.ch clearly shows the electrical scheme to be a to actuate

scheme. Normal electrical maintenance prattice would be to review drawings and check for electrical potential before lifting wires. This normal practice should have caught the incorrect job plan. Since the qrawings were not reviewed, the error in the job plan went undetected.

  • "*ov10 ., .. , ;,o E "'*IS t'."li 15 OOClllT lfUM911'1 121 ..... '" *&QI iJl .... ... Palisades Plant 0 5 0 0 0 2 5 5 9 2 -0 0 9 _ .,._ 0 0 . 0 3 OF 0 3 TUT,. --* .__ --/IC_ ...... .-.a*,, 1111 An additional weakness was noted in the job plan in that post maintenance testing was inadequate

.. A continuity check of wire was performed, however, more thorough post mai.ntenance testing would be expected following the removal and re-termination of a wire from a safety-related relay. CORRECTIVE ACTION . . The f611owing corrective actjons have been completed:

1. Restate expectation that electricians review job plan and prints thoroughly before ariy physical Also, point out requirement for check of potential from both a safety and proper work practice standpoint

.. Review both actions with the I&C staff and I&C and document on in-plant training form.

  • 2 .. Review proper job planning requirements with planners to emphasize a review of all prints and the importance of proper post maintenance testing in accordance .with Administrative Procedure 5.19; ADDITIONAL INFORMATION Norie
